Output e673368476ee66ba9052bbc60e05266642fb11cb1c15d6853df32dd46cf15806:49

value
923465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beefbfabbddffb244c4b6cd32ed2d601ef7a5ab OP_EQUAL
address
3Qf7pcWfsd6Z1aaAgs9hF2vF4gnxrB3MSp
transaction
e673368476ee66ba9052bbc60e05266642fb11cb1c15d6853df32dd46cf15806
spent
true